Left leg front kick to the head by Morehouse is deflected by Loring Green during NAKF individual tournament sparring. Green and Morehouse then paired up to win 1st place in the 2010 Battle for Boston two-on-two fighting event. (In the Kid’s Karate Class there is no contact to the face.)

Schedule Update to the Town’s site:
New Beginners - Friday classes (held every other Friday) are when material for beginners is taught. Therefore note that you need to sign up for the Tues& Fri option (not just Tuesdays) while your student is starting out.
Summer Break :
The class is in recess for the last 2 weeks of July and the first 2 weeks of August. See also the summer session schedule at the town’s site.
